DEVICE FOR A BUCKET
This invention relates to a device tor a bucket of a digging machine, which in a usual way comprises a hydraulically operable arm, which is arranged to be detachably fastened on the bucket, the outer portion of the arm comprising a plate-formed means, which is intended to be detachably applied on an outer delimitation surface of the bucket, and a plurality of shim means being fastened on the delimitation surface and accordingly positioned between the bucket and the plate-formed means of the arm ofthe digging machine.
The purpose of these shim means is to give a more stable and secure fastening of the plate-formed means of the arm of the digging machine against the bucket itself and the shim means as a rule are fastened to the bucket by screwing. This means that if there is a desire to exchange existing shim means for such ones having another thickness, the procedure becomes very time-consuming. The reason why it is necessary to exchange existing shim means for other means, which are thicker than the existing ones, is that there often arises a play in the connection between the bucket ofthe digging machine and the plate-formed means of the arm o the digging machine due to wear in the equipment. This invention relates to a device, which makes a simplified handling possible when exchanging existing shim means for such ones having another thickness. This has been made possible by the fact that each shim means has such a design appearing from the claims.
A preferred embodiment of the invention shall be described more closely below with reference to the accompanying drawings, where Fig. 1 shows the positioning of the shim means on the bucket of the digging machine,
Fig. 2 shows a detailed picture of a shim means according to the invention. and Fig. 3 shows a section along the line III-III through the shim means according to Fig. 2. Referring to Fig. 1 is shown there the outer portion of a hydraulically operable arm 1. which is arranged on a not shown digging machine. This arm is articulately fastened on a plate-formed means 2, which is intended to be detachably fastened on an outer delimitation surface 3 of a bucket 4 or the like. In order to prevent play between the means 2 and the delimitation surface 3 and accordingly improve the connection between these ones, a plurality of schematically shown shim means 5 are arranged on the outer delimitation surface 3 of the bucket 4.
These shim means 5, after the use for a period, have to be exchanged for thicker means due to the strong wear arising on the equipment during the digging procedure. This is facilitated to a high extent by the new invention. In Fig. 2 a shim means 5 according to the invention is shown more closely. This means is made of a suitable metallic material and has a rectangularly or squarely designed frame 6 comprising two parallel side portions 7, 8 and a front portion 9 connecting the side portions 7, 8. A spacing piece 10 is insertably arranged between the side portions. This spacing piece has such a design that its portion in relation to the frame portions can be changed in the vertical direction V, seen in Fig. 3. However, the top surface of the two side portions 7, 8 has projections 1 1, 12 (see Fig. 3), directed inwards, i.e. towards the middle part of the frame, which are intended to be able to cooperate with projections 13. 14, directed outwards, of respective side portion 21a, b of he lower part of the spacing piece 10, whereby the spacing piece 10 cannot be taken out from the frame 6 of the shim means 5 in the vertical direction.
The shim means 5 at its rear portion has a detachable back piece 15, which connects the side portions 7, 8 of the frame 6 with each other and is held together with these ones by means of two suitable screw means 16, 17. This back piece is intended to held together the spacing piece 10 with the frame portions 7, 8, 9.
In accordance to what has been stated previously there is a possibility of a certain movability in the vertical direction for the spacing piece 10 in relation to the surrounding frame portions 7, 8, 9, 15. Thus, this movability shall permit detachable plates 18 to be able to be inserted under the spacing piece 10 and be positioned between the side portions 7, 8 of the frame 6.
In the normal position, i.e. when no plates 18 are inserted into the shim means 5, the undersurface 19 of the spacing piece 10 is applied against the bedding, i.e. the outer delimitation surface of the bucket 4, the upper surface 20 of the spacing piece 10 being substantially on the same level as the upper surface of the side portions 7, 8. However, as is shown in Fig. 3, the upper surface 20 of the spacing piece 10 can be raised above the upper surface of the side portions 7, 8 by the fact that loose plates 18, suitably made of metallic material, are inserted into the shim means 5 under the spacing piece 10.
When using the new invention the following happens: The two frame side portions 7. 8 and the front frame portion 9, connecting the side portions 7, 8 with each other, of each shim means are fixed by welding on the outer delimitation surface 3 of the bucket 4. Thereafter the spacing piece is inserted between the side portions 7, 8 and back piece 15 is fastened. When applying the plate-formed means of the arm of the digging machine against the outer delimitation surface 3 of the bucket 4. the underside of the plate-formed means 2 will accordingly rest against the pluralin of shim means 5, which accordingly eliminate possible play between the plate-formed means 2 and the outer delimitation surface 3 of the bucket 4. As the time goes and the digging machine works, a play between the plate-formed means 2 of the arm 1 of the digging machine and the bucket 4 begins again to arise. In this situation the plate-formed means 2 is loosened from the bucket, whereafter the back piece 15 of the shim means 5 is loosened. One or more plates 18 of such a thickness that the play between the plate-formed means 2 and the bucket 4 is eliminated are inserted under the spacing piece 10 of the shim means 5, whereafter the back piece 15 is put back and locks the inserting plates 18 to a fixed position. In this situation the digging machine is ready for effective use for another period of time.
The invention is of course not limited to the shown and mentioned embodiment but can be modified within the scope ofthe following claims.
